![]() I have set up a macro to import multiple text files. When opening th text file(s) the following error/warning msg appears -"This file is no a recognisable format"-. The macro then suspends until you select "OK on the msg. Is there any way to avoid having to press "Enter" (i.e. to select "OK" as I am getting a bit fustrated "OK"-ing about 50 times (the number o text files) each time I import.
